No, the Mojave Desert is not the coldest desert. While it can experience cold temperatures, particularly at night during the winter, the coldest desert is generally considered to be the Antarctic Desert, which has extremely low temperatures year-round. Other cold deserts include the Gobi Desert in Central Asia. The Mojave is classified as a hot desert, characterized by hot summers and mild winters.
